      ALEXANDER GRAHAM BELL. Occupation: Inventor. Born: March 3, 1847 in Edinburgh, Scotland. Died: August 2, 1922 in Nova Scotia, Canada. Best known for: Inventing the telephone. Alexander Early life. He grew up in Scotland and was home schooled by his father who was a professor. He later attended high school as well as Edinburgh University.
